The Aircrew Technical Publications Team:
Our team delivers approved technical data that empowers air forces to operate and maintain their aircraft, from cockpit-ready publications to interactive digital resources for ground crews.
In this role, you'll be at the forefront of ensuring the integrity of our deliverables-performing conformance checks, producing Engineering Statements and Declarations, and collaborating with a diverse, multi-level stakeholder base. You'll be a key player in maintaining configuration control while developing your expertise, working with European partners, and expanding your professional network.

Please be aware that many roles at BAE Systems are subject to both security and export control restrictions. These restrictions mean that factors such as your nationality, any nationalities you may have previously held, and your place of birth can restrict the roles you are eligible to perform within the organisation. All applicants must as a minimum achieve Baseline Personnel Security Standard. Many roles also require higher levels of National Security Vetting where applicants must typically have 5 to 10 years of continuous residency in the UK depending on the vetting level required for the role, to allow for meaningful security vetting checks.
